Segmented Therapeutic Delivery via Acoustic Microbubble Relay
An acoustically driven, modular segmented delivery system is presented to overcome mechanical limitations of conventional microcatheters. Oscillating microbubbles generate directional streaming that enables continuous, targeted transport across open, angled segments.

Miniaturized Conductometric Biosensor for Rapid Detection of TNF‐α in Saliva
A miniaturized conductometric sensor detects TNF‐α at femtomolar levels with high selectivity. The device enables noninvasive testing using pooled human saliva and supports smartphone‐based, real‐time resistance readings.
